Formosa 2 offshore wind farm

Consultancy services The Formosa 2 offshore wind farm project is located in the Taiwan Strait and is being jointly developed by JERA (49%), Macquarie’s Green Investment Group (26%) and Swancor Renewable Energy (25%). Lhyfe | Offshore floating wind farm 1GW + H2 production

The project DORIS studied a case for offshore hydrogen production from power delivered by a floating wind farm. Various solutions for hydrogen production studied and compared (offshore distributed/centralized, onshore). Positive conclusion on offshore distributed hydrogen production.
